博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
Oracle数据库常用监控语句
阅读量:6917 次
发布时间:2019-06-27

本文共 1897 字,大约阅读时间需要 6 分钟。

--在某个用户下找所有的索引select user_indexes.table_name, user_indexes.index_name,uniqueness, column_namefrom user_ind_columns, user_indexeswhere user_ind_columns.index_name = user_indexes.index_nameand user_ind_columns.table_name = user_indexes.table_name order by user_indexes.table_type, user_indexes.table_name,user_indexes.index_name, column_position;--监控表空间的I/O比例select df.tablespace_name name,df.file_name "file",f.phyrds pyr,f.phyblkrd pbr,f.phywrts pyw,f.phyblkwrt pbw from v$filestat f,dba_data_files dfwhere f.file#=df.file_id--监控 SGA 中字典缓冲区的命中率select parameter, gets,Getmisses , getmisses/(gets+getmisses)*100 "miss ratio",(1-(sum(getmisses)/ (sum(gets)+sum(getmisses))))*100 "Hit ratio"from v$rowcache where gets+getmisses <>0group by parameter, gets, getmisses;--监控 SGA 的命中率select a.value + b.value "logical_reads", c.value "phys_reads",round(100 * ((a.value+b.value)-c.value) / (a.value+b.value)) "BUFFER HIT RATIO" from v$sysstat a, v$sysstat b, v$sysstat cwhere a.statistic# = 38 and b.statistic# = 39 and c.statistic# = 40;--监控内存和硬盘的排序比率,最好使它小于 .10,增加 sort_area_sizeSELECT name, value FROM v$sysstat WHERE name IN ('sorts (memory)', 'sorts (disk)');--查看碎片程度高的表SELECT segment_name table_name , COUNT(*) extentsFROM dba_segments WHERE owner NOT IN ('SYS', 'SYSTEM') GROUP BY segment_nameHAVING COUNT(*) = (SELECT MAX( COUNT(*) ) FROM dba_segments GROUP BY segment_name);--找使用CPU多的用户sessionselect a.sid,spid,status,substr(a.program,1,40) prog,a.terminal,osuser,value/60/100 value from v$session a,v$process b,v$sesstat c where c.statistic#=12 and c.sid=a.sid and a.paddr=b.addr order by value desc;--监控log_buffer的使用情况:(值最好小于1%,否则增加log_buffer 的大小)select rbar.name,rbar.value,re.name,re.value,(rbar.value*100)/re.value||'%' "radio" from v$sysstat rbar,v$sysstat re where rbar.name='redo buffer allocation retries' and re.name='redo entries';

 引用链接:

转载于:https://www.cnblogs.com/fxust/p/8117843.html

你可能感兴趣的文章
python-sqlalchemy安装各种细节
查看>>
【转载做哈笔记】single sign-on
查看>>
cocos2dx 适合初学者的学习笔记【三】
查看>>
ELK(ElasticSearch+Logstash+Kibana)+redis日志收集分析系统
查看>>
nginx部署
查看>>
ClusterControl DB 集群测试
查看>>
dot 学习笔记二
查看>>
Qt学习之路(20): 事件接收与忽略
查看>>
懒人建站之电视直播插件
查看>>
Java迭代器
查看>>
IOS开发之UIImageView
查看>>
Redis的初步安装
查看>>
jQuery键盘控制方法,以及键值(keycode)对照表
查看>>
Android 踩坑记录
查看>>
mysql 大数据查询的解决方式
查看>>
web用户登录测试用例设计
查看>>
Windows 10下搭建Maven 私服仓库
查看>>
提交自己的pods到公共的cocoapods
查看>>
Nivo Slider 使用文档说明 jq简单幻灯片切换
查看>>
用phpMyadmin创建独立的数据库帐号
查看>>